Well, it's time we start the next character, and... after consideration, I decided that Jax would be the next choice. So without further ado..

Jax’s storyline (debatably) begins in Special Forces. When the leader of the Black Dragon, Kano broke 4 fellow members of his clan out of Special Forces custody, these included Jarek, Tasia, No Face and Tremor. With help from Gemini, Jax brought all of them back into custody and then pursued Kano to Outworld. Kano was planning on using the Eye of Shitian to make everyone into his slaves, starting with Jax. Jax defeated Kano and used the Eye of Shitian to transport Kano and himself back to Earthrealm.*

After the tournament, Jax found Johnny Cage at the remains of Shang Tsung’s island, taking Cage into custody. Cage told Jax of all that had happened, but Jax refused to believe it. Sometime later, Jax received a distress signal from Sonya, it was coming from Outworld. Before it was cut off, Sonya told Jax that the Outworld warriors were planning on going after Johnny Cage and Liu Kang. With that, Jax headed towards the filming studio where Johnny Cage was at, only to find it under attack. Jax fought with Kintaro as his partner Baren was killed by Mileena.

When Raiden told the warriors of Shao Kahn’s invasion and how they must go to Outworld, Jax agreed to go upon learning of Beran’s death. Though it is unknown who Jax fought in the tournament, it’s safe to say that he did not win. Though he succeeded in freeing Sonya from her chains, as well as Kano.

As the Earth warriors fled back to Outworld, Kano escaped back through the portal before it closed, but both Jax and Sonya knew that it would only be matter of time before they crossed paths with him again.

Jax tried to warn his superiors of Outworld’s impending invasion, but lacking proof, he was ignored. He donned bionic implants onto his arms for the upcoming war. When Outworld’s invasion began, Jax fought as one of Earth’s “Chosen Warriors”. After Shao Kahn was defeated, Jax and Sonya started the Outworld Investigation Agency, where he led the first exposition into Outworld.

Later, when Sonya disappeared after trying to track down the last member of the Black Dragon, Jarek. Jax followed her, where he discovered of Shinnok’s invasion of Edenia, he joined with his fellow Earthrealm warriors once again and helped to stop the fallen Elder God.

Sometime later, he had found Cyrax malfunctioning in the desert, he and Sonya helped Cyrax restore his human soul. He then joined the Outworld Investigation Agency as a form of gratitude.

Years later, Jax received a message from Agent Kenshi about a new threat in Outworld, but before Jax could act, the traitor Hsu Hao had destroyed the portal to Outworld with a miniature nuclear weapon. Jax barely escaped with his life. After informing Sonya of its destruction, Jax was met by Raiden, who told him to go to Shang Tsung’s island. Once he arrived there, Jax along with his other Earthrealm allies learned of Liu Kang’s death and the formation of the Deadly Alliance.

Once they were in Outworld, Jax went in search of Hsu Hao, who had leapt through the portal before it was destroyed. Eventually, Jax caught up with Hsu Hao and ripped the cybernetic heart from his chest, effectively killing him.

During the final confrontation with the Deadly Alliance, Jax was killed in the assault, but he did not stay dead long for he and his other allies were revived by the Dragon King and made into his slaves. What happens to Jax next remains to be seen.
